![]() ![]() | Re: New FX verses Upgrade Package I trained mostly on the O2ptima Rebreather (second generation, prototype) & purchased an O2ptima FX. As to differences... the tanks are secured via a device called a "Remora," and from what I understand, getting it to fit exactly per your height/size is wicked, but Charles at Fill Express is pretty much an expert now. The Remora holds the tanks in a more rigid position than the bungee did, which is a positive. The negative is that cylinders are no longer interchangebale between units. I'll be shipping a set of cylinders to Hawaii just that reason. Also, below the tank valves there is a bottom plate bolted to the frame. It is moveable if you need to switch out cylinder sizes. The case is slightly more streamlined, and the cylinder valves project farther from the case than in the older model. For Petite Divers such as me (yes, I used caps), DiveRite is offering smaller, redesigned counterlungs which are wider at the shoulder than the base. This helps prevent CO2 being caught in the counterlung, among other things that we Petite Divers understand best... :-) Smaller hoses are also due, and there are more changes to come- all of which I assume will be available for both the FX and the Op2tima. | Moderator ![]() ![]() ![]() ![]() Current Rebreather/s: | Re: New FX verses Upgrade Package To change from the old version to the FX, they take the plate onto which everything is mounted, cut it down to a smaller size, put on the new mounting foot at the base, add the Remora mounts and put on a new cover. So, as far as the "rebreather" equipment goes, that is the same (head unit, handsets, etc.). The FX uses a new tank mounting system, adds an adjustable size to the case, and puts a new case on that allows for this. Like SeaFox said, it is now even easier (as if it weren't before ) to open the canister for changing the scrubber. You can open just the top of the case to change the scrubber, you can open just the bottom of the case, and you can take off the entire back of the case (bottom and top). On the old version, to open the case was more cumbersome, and you would end out laying down the unit (not a big deal but still more work) to get inside. On the FX, you can just take off the back, and leave the unit standing (which it does much better than with the old case). The older case (especially the first version) tended to trap air and water inside, making the initial descent more work, and weighing down the unit when climbing out of the water. (I fixed this by getting a few holes made in the case to allow the gas/water to escape. So, it is not a big deal.) The new case easily fills/drains. The new version is not strictly cosmetic in the changes. However, I would have no qualms about diving an older version. The new improvements are certainly more convenient and efficient. So, that's why I would make the change if I were to buy an older version. |
